COMPARISON OF AI-GENERATED CONCEPTUAL INTERIOR DESIGNS USING STANDARDIZED PROMPTS IN VARIOUS AI MODELS

Öz

This study evaluates the performance of three widely-used text-to-image AI models—DALL-E, MidJourney, and Stable Diffusion—in generating interior design visuals. Five standardized prompts, covering essential design elements such as architectural features, style, furniture, lighting, textiles, accessories, and layout, were provided to each AI model. The resulting visuals were then assessed by 15 experienced professionals and academics with over 10 years of expertise in interior design. Using a detailed rating system, the study found that MidJourney consistently outperformed the others, excelling in categories like design style, textiles, and lighting. DALL-E proved effective in generating architectural features but struggled with finer details, particularly in textiles and lighting. Stable Diffusion lagged behind in overall performance, especially in categories like layout and furniture. The study highlights the importance of prompt specificity in shaping AI-generated visuals and suggests areas for future improvement in AI models, particularly in complex design tasks.
